You don't need a week off to ride something special out of Bangalore. Some of our most-loved outings are over before the city has finished its first coffee — dawn blasts to a fort, a lake, or a hill, and home by lunch.

Nandi Hills at sunrise

Forty curves in the dark, then sunrise above a sea of fog from an 18th-century hill fortress. It's the classic Bangalore ride for a reason. Get there before the gates get busy, and reward yourself with dosa and filter coffee on the way down.

Granite and silk at Ramanagara

South-west of the city, Ramanagara's giant granite domes — the backdrop of an old Bollywood classic — make for a short, scenic loop through silk-weaving towns and quiet backroads. Perfect for a newer rider finding their rhythm.

The best rides aren't always the longest. Sometimes they're just the earliest.

Both run best October to February, in the cool dry months. Start before dawn, and beat both the heat and the traffic.
